Ultimately, the quintessential commonly examined variant of FUT2 gene is the SNP rs602662

This SNP was also reported to be in LD with the SNPs rs601338 (r 2 = 0.76) and rs516316 (r 2 = 0.83) in Caucasian populations from the USA and Iceland [12, 29]. Zinck et al. reported that ‘A’ allele carriers of the rs602662 variant were at a lower risk of vitamin B12 deficiency (< 148 pmol/l) (OR 0.61, 95% CI 0.47–0.80, P = 3.0 ? 10 ?4 ) in a population of 3114 Canadian adults . Similarly, a higher vitamin B12 status was observed in carriers of the ‘A' allele in four different studies looking at Caucasians (? = 0.04– pmol/l) [12, 20, 21, 29] and Indians (? = 0.10–0.25 pmol/l) [22, 27]. Furthermore, additional variants of the FUT2 gene were observed to be associated with vitamin B12 levels (P < 0.05) in the following SNPs: rs1047781, rs516316, rs838133 and rs281379 [12, 19, 22].

Furthermore, additional variants of the FUT6 gene (rs708686 [12, 22], rs78060698 , rs3760775 and rs7788053 ) were observed to be associated with a higher vitamin B12 status in individuals of the Indian, Icelandic and Danish populations (P < 0.05). Bioinformatic analysis has shown that the FUT3, FUT5 and FUT6 genes form a cluster on chromosome 19p13.3 . Interestingly, the SNPs rs3760775, rs10409772, rs12019136, rs78060698, rs17855739, rs79744308, rs7250982 and rs8111600 from this cluster were in LD with the FUT6 SNP rs3760775 (r 2 = 0.57–0.84) in South Asian populations. Available data has shown differences in the LD structure between South Asian populations and individuals of East Asian and European origin . The variation of LD patterns across ethnicities could account for the heterogeneity of vitamin B12 concentrations .
